Texas Instruments Launches the World’s Smallest MCU, Measuring Just 1.38mm²

Texas Instruments Launches the World's Smallest MCU, Measuring Just 1.38mm²

On March 12, Texas Instruments (TI) unveiled the world’s smallest microcontroller (MCU), the MSPM0C1104, at the Embedded World exhibition in Germany. It measures just 1.38mm², which is 38% smaller than the current smallest MCU on the market, with a unit price of approximately $0.16. Hidden Costs of Isolated RS-485 Optocoupler Design Optocouplers, also known as optical isolators or optoelectronic couplers, have been used for over 40 years to achieve current isolation in electronic circuits. Optocouplers use LEDs and phototransistors to communicate signals without transmitting current. As a low-cost solution, optocouplers have remained popular.
